Does anyone know of a DMV in northern NJ that does not have a long line around the block before they even open?

I used to go to the one in Wallington, but for the past 3 months there are people camping out there well before 8AM, and the line continues to stay outside and to the street all during the day.

There has been much press and publicity about this recently and I do believe as the other guy mentioned its toughest or busiest around beginning/end of month. Recently there was news that lic renewals would fall on birthdates rather that end of month to spread this out.

I did notice that Rahway which is notorious for long lines was rather light this evening as i passed it on its late night.

Sometimes if you're traveling you might find a quieter low volume agency in a smaller less traveled location.

Otherwise some of these tricks the DMV are trying might work and you might luck out.
